#f8e278 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f8e278 is composed of 97.3% red, 88.6%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.9% magenta, 51.6%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 49.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 72.2%. #f8e278 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#f1c500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

● #f8e278 color description : Soft yellow.
The hexadecimal color #f8e278 has RGB values of R:248, G:226,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.52,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16310904.
